UFC Vegas 107 looked absolutely awful on paper, but in practice, we did have some exciting moments. The ladies’ fights were somewhat underwhelming, though. Alice Ardelean defeated Rayanne dos Santos, which wasn’t a terrible watch and even won FOTN. However, Macy Chiasson vs. Ketlen Vieira was a complete slog of a contest that saw Vieira victorious. Side note: Chris Leben turned in an awful score card for that fight. Dusko Todorovic was bested by Zachary Reese in another ho-hum bout of no consequence. On the prelims, we were treated to just one finish, courtesy of Jordan Leavitt. The main card saw more action with finishes from Dustin Jacoby and an incredibly violent one from Ramiz Brahimaj, who looked like he was trying to rip Billy Ray Goff’s head off his body. If you’re wondering about Blanchfield vs. Barber, that fight got canceled due to a medical issue with Maycee Barber. That’s right, folks, the main event got scratched mere moments before Barber’s walkout (Blanchfield made the walk). Hopefully, Maycee makes a full recovery and Erin gets her show and win money.
